Description Przemek Klosowski 2019-09-11 19:22:06 UTC
Description of problem:  grace won't run due to missing fonts


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
grace-5.1.23-4.el7.x86_64

How reproducible: every time


Steps to Reproduce:
1. xmgrace

Actual results:
--> Broken or incomplete installation - read the FAQ!


Expected results: running grace, opens the application window

Comment 1 Przemek Klosowski 2019-09-11 19:40:39 UTC
This is due to missing fonts. /etc/grace/FontDataBase defines a bunch of fonts from /usr/share/grace/fonts/type1
 which symlinks to /usr/share/fonts/default/Type1 , which is empty on RHEL7.
On later Fedoras xmgrace RPM (e.g. grace-5.1.25-12.fc27.x86_64) brings its own set of 35 fonts, so probably the fix should be to release e.g. grace-5.1.25 for el7

Comment 2 Alex Owen 2019-09-30 17:20:13 UTC
As stated above for grace-5.1.23-4.el7.x86_64 /etc/grace/FontDataBase defines a bunch of fonts from /usr/share/grace/fonts/type1
 which symlinks to /usr/share/fonts/default/Type1.

Further digging shows:

/usr/share/fonts/default/Type1 used to be populated by urw-fonts
BUT urw-fonts is obsoleted by meta-package urw-base35-fonts which pulls in several urw-base35-*-fonts packages which place their font data in different directories with different names.

xmgrace therefore cannot find them!!!
